Elsass, also known as Alsace, is a region in France currently in the news due to developments regarding its autonomy and the recognition of its cultural heritage. Historically, Alsace has been a region of contention between France and Germany, influencing its unique cultural identity. Recently, the region has taken a significant step towards greater autonomy, with a controversial bill gaining support in the French parliament. This bill's passage was notable because it required the support of right-wing populists, signaling a shift in political alliances. Furthermore, a drawing by German Renaissance master Hans Baldung Grien, depicting an Alsatian citizen, was declared a national treasure by French authorities, preventing its auction and highlighting the region's artistic significance. These events underscore Alsace's ongoing efforts to define its regional identity and preserve its cultural heritage within France.
